Difference between ARP and RARP
State the difference between the ARP and RARP?
Expert
The address resolution protocol (ARP) is used in order to link the 32 bit IP address along with the 48 bit physical address, which is used by the host or the router in order to find the physical address of another host upon its network by sending the ARP query packet which involves the IP address of the receiver. The reverse address resolution protocol (RARP) enables the host to discover its Internet address if it knows only its physical address.
